AMERICA’S LABOR WAR
DISORDER INCREASING.
VARIOUS DISTRICTS AFFECTED,
Press Association—By Telegraph—Copyright.
NEW YORK, July 26.
(Received July 27, at 10.35 a.m.)
With tire Government controlling the freight- traffic in East Mississippi, disorders on the part of the railway strikes are increasing. Tho Chicago police wero forced to fire on crowds of rioters who attacked shop workers. Two Detroit workers were stabbed by strikers. Denison (Texas) has been placed under martial law owing to threatened violence; Additional troops are required in various parts of Pennsylvania.—A. and N.Z. Cablo
